Required Skills & Experience
- 2+ years of software or systems engineering experience (exceptional early-career candidates with relevant low-level work will be considered)
- Strong experience working close to the operating system layer (kernel, memory management, process execution, or runtime internals)
- Demonstrated ability to write high-performance, production-quality code
- Experience with debugging, reverse engineering, or dynamic analysis techniques
- Proven ownership mindset-ability to take a problem from concept through deployment
- Comfortable working in a highly ambiguous, research-heavy environment
- Ability to work onsite in Washington, D.C. five days per week
- Eligible to obtain and maintain U.S. security clearance
Desired Skills & Experience
- Background in offensive security, vulnerability research, exploit development, or CTF competitions
- Experience building or contributing to low-level tooling, systems infrastructure, or OS instrumentation
- Exposure to AI/ML systems, particularly applied to security or automation
- Prior work at high-performance engineering organizations, startups, or advanced R&D environments
- Experience with runtime detection, binary instrumentation, or sandboxing systems
- Open-source contributions in security, operating systems, or developer tooling
What You Will Be Doing
Tech Breakdown
- 60% Low-level systems engineering (OS internals, kernel interfaces, performance optimization)
- 25% Offensive security tooling and automation (vulnerability discovery, exploit systems)
- 15% AI-assisted research and system design
Daily Responsibilities
- 70% Hands-on engineering (designing and building production systems)
- 10% Collaboration with researchers and operators
- 20% System design, architecture, and experimentation
Engineers in this role will design and build systems that automate traditionally manual cyber operations, partnering closely with offensive security specialists to operationalize research into scalable platforms. Work will frequently involve deep technical challenges at the intersection of operating systems, performance engineering, and adversarial problem-solving.
